The education system and global needs in 2050 will likely be influenced by various factors such as technological advancements, demographic changes, and global economic and political shifts. Here are some potential trends that could shape the education system and global needs in 2050:
Lifelong Learning: With the rapid pace of technological advancement and evolving job markets, the need for individuals to continually update their skills and knowledge through lifelong learning will become even more critical. Education systems may need to adapt to this reality by providing more flexible and accessible learning opportunities, such as online courses and micro-credentials.
STEM Education: In a world where technology and automation are transforming many industries, there will likely be a growing demand for individuals with STEM (science, technology, engineering, and math) skills. Education systems may need to focus more on developing these skills in students to prepare them for the jobs of the future.
Global Citizenship Education: With the increasing interconnectedness of the world, there will be a growing need for individuals who understand global issues and are able to work collaboratively across cultural and national boundaries. Education systems may need to incorporate more global citizenship education into their curricula to help students develop these skills.
Climate Change and Sustainability Education: As the impacts of climate change become more severe, there will be a greater need for individuals who understand the science behind it and are equipped to take action to address it. Education systems may need to prioritize climate change and sustainability education to prepare students to be responsible global citizens.
Access to Education: Despite progress in recent years, there are still many people around the world who lack access to education. In 2050, there will likely still be a need to increase access to education, particularly in low-income and developing countries.
Overall, the education system and global needs in 2050 will likely be shaped by a need to prepare individuals for a rapidly changing world, as well as a need to address global challenges such as climate change, inequality, and technological disruption.
While computer and communication engineering will certainly continue to play an important role in shaping the future, there are many other core areas of education that will also be critical in 2050 and beyond. Here are some of the core areas of education that are likely to be important in the future:
Sustainability and Environmental Studies: As the world faces pressing environmental and sustainability challenges, education that focuses on sustainability and environmental studies will be crucial. This includes education on renewable energy, climate change, conservation, and sustainable development.
Artificial Intelligence and Machine Learning: As artificial intelligence and machine learning continue to advance, education in these fields will be increasingly important. This includes understanding how these technologies work, how to develop and use them, and how they can be used to solve real-world problems.
Health Sciences: With an aging population and increasing health challenges, education in the health sciences will continue to be important. This includes education on medicine, public health, nutrition, and other related fields.
Social Sciences: Education in the social sciences will remain important as societies continue to face challenges related to inequality, social justice, and political stability. This includes education on sociology, psychology, political science, and economics.
Entrepreneurship and Innovation: Education in entrepreneurship and innovation will be important as individuals and organizations seek to develop new products, services, and business models. This includes education on business management, marketing, and technology development.
While computer and communication engineering will continue to be important, education in a range of other fields will also be critical in shaping the future. Education in sustainability, artificial intelligence, health sciences, social sciences, entrepreneurship, and innovation will all be crucial in 2050 and beyond.
